Australia secured a commanding 98-run victory over the Netherlands in the Women's T20 World Cup, setting a new tournament record by becoming the first team to cross 200 runs. Beth Mooney's 74 and Ashleigh Gardner's 58 were key to their 219/6 total, while the Netherlands showed resilience with Babette de Leede's unbeaten 56.
